For the Deku Tree Hands, and Hands in general;

Aside from what everyone else has suggested, just use Spears on them. The long reach keeps the Gloom at the base of them away just out of reach of you as you jab the poo poo outta them. Also make some Sundelion-enhanced food to treat the Gloom'ed hearts.

I've finally beaten all 152 shrines. Thank god for the sensor or I wouldn't have found like 30 of these things they're hidden so well. I've now got what appears to be full hearts at 38. There's also an additional prize as well: You get a suit of the Ancient Hero. Which is the one from the Calamity Mural with the red hair and tail. It's a Zonai looking suit like Rauru or Mineru. And it's a one piece suit, not three parts like others. Very cool looking.

Puffshrooms are perhaps the strongest consumable in the game for fighting crowds of mooks, just 20 second stunlock of a entire area and you can always throw another.
